The Quebec government offers various benefits and credits throughout the month of March for Quebec residents seeking additional financial support to cope with inflation.
It is best to confirm your eligibility for these government programs, as qualifying for these financial payments can increase your income by hundreds of dollars.
The Quebec government offers many credits and benefits including the Quebec Pension Plan, Old Age Security, Canadian Workers' Benefits, among others.
Here is everything you need to know about the upcoming Revenu Quebec benefits and credits that will be paid in March:
Quebec Pension Plan
According to Revenu Quebec, the Quebec Pension Plan (QPP) is a mandatory public insurance program designed for individuals aged 18 and older who earn an annual employment income exceeding $3,500.
Its primary goal is to help individuals working in Quebec, along with their families, achieve basic financial security in cases of retirement, death, or disability.
In other parts of Canada, there is a similar program known as the Canada Pension Plan (CPP).
For those who choose direct deposit, the public sector retirement pension will be paid on the fifteenth day of each month for the rest of your life.
